  • The JugglerThe Juggler Posts: 48,527
    wow.

    actually when you go back and look at reid's drafts post '04 the last impact player he drafted on defense was trent cole. i guess you could say mike patterson too--same year, 2005.

    since then they've got a few starters in the later rounds but no real impact, pro bowl caliber players since 2005. stu bradely was the closest thing and i think they gave up on him too early.

    Philly reporters mix it up

    On Tuesday, Jeff McLane of the Philadelphia Inquirer and Les Bowen of the Philadelphia Daily News got into a Twitter-style pissing match, as chronicled by the folks at CrossingBroad.com.

    On Wednesday, the dispute took on a new dimension, with Bowen and McLane getting into a physical altercation at the team’s facility.

    Howard Eskin of NBC 10 and WIP reports via Twitter that Bowen “connect[ed] 2 the head” of McLane, and that the two had to be separated. The pair had to be separated.

    We’ve had minor scuffles with each guy in the past (actually, all three — even though Howard is now a friend of PFT), but we can’t imagine verbal/written spats ever taking on a physical component. Whoever made the first move needs to be fired.
